Discover the advantages of FRAXplus®
FRAXplus® allows you to modify a probability result derived from conventional FRAX estimates of probabilities of hip fracture and major osteoporotic fracture with knowledge of:
- Recency of osteoporotic fracture
- Higher than average exposure to oral glucocorticoids
- Information on trabecular bone score (TBS)
- Number of falls in the previous year
- Duration of Type 2 diabetes mellitus
- Concurrent information on lumbar spine BMD
- Hip axis length (HAL)
- Primary hyperparathyroidism
- Number of prior fractures
Caveat : There is no evidence base available to inform on the accuracy of multiple adjustments. Pragmatically, any adjustment should be made for the most dominant factor, i.e., that which is likely to have the greatest clinical relevance for the estimated probability.
